[EMU] Ymir v0.1.3: Nuove Funzionalità, Miglioramenti e Correzioni!

Ymir è un emulatore per Sega Saturn in costante sviluppo, che mira a offrire un’esperienza accurata e ricca di funzionalità. La versione v0.1.3 introduce numerosi miglioramenti, tra cui supporto per macOS, cartucce ROM e molto altro!


🔹 Novità Principali

✅ Supporto macOS (Intel e Apple Silicon)

Finalmente disponibile per macOS, sia su Mac Intel che Apple Silicon, grazie al lavoro di @Wunkolo (#49, #65, #95, #96).

🎮 Supporto per Cartucce ROM

Ora compatibili:

  • The King of Fighters ’95

  • Ultraman: Hikari no Kyojin Densetsu

L’emulatore carica automaticamente la cartuccia necessaria quando viene inserito il gioco corrispondente (opzione disattivabile).

🌍 Rilevamento Automatico PAL/NTSC

Ymir passa automaticamente tra PAL (50Hz) e NTSC (60Hz) in base alla regione del gioco.

🎛️ Miglioramenti al Sistema di Input

  • Turbo Mode Toggle: Nuova opzione per attivare/disattivare la modalità turbo (tasto predefinito: `).

  • Gamepad indipendenti: I controller non vengono più fusi in un unico dispositivo.

  • Azioni ripetibili: Tenendo premuto un tasto, è possibile ripetere azioni come l’avanzamento frame-by-frame.

🖥️ Modalità Schermo Intero & UI Migliorata

  • Full screen mode (Alt+Invio) con supporto a VRR (Variable Refresh Rate).

  • Riduzione dell’input lag (ora paragonabile a Mednafen).

  • Indicatori di stato in-game (riavvolgimento, pausa, turbo, etc.).

🎨 Correzioni Grafiche e Audio

  • Fix per glitch in giochi Capcom e Dragon Ball Z.

  • Miglioramenti all’emulazione SCSP (audio), ora più accurata di Mednafen in alcuni test.


🔹 Caratteristiche Principali di Ymir

✅ Supporto per:

  • BIN+CUE, IMG+CCD, MDF+MDS, ISO

  • Cartucce Backup RAM e DRAM

  • Fino a 2 giocatori (in espansione)

🎮 Funzionalità avanzate:

  • Save states

  • Rewind (fino a 1 minuto a 60 fps)

  • Turbo mode e frame step (avanti/indietro)

  • Debugger in sviluppo


🔹 Come Usare Ymir

📥 Installazione

  1. Scarica l’ultima versione da GitHub Releases.

  2. Estrai e avvia l’eseguibile (su Windows potrebbe servire Visual C++ Redistributable).

⚙️ Configurazione

  • IPL (BIOS): Ymir richiede una ROM BIOS nella cartella roms (creata al primo avvio).

  • Comandi da terminale:

    ymir-sdl3 --help  # Mostra le opzioni
    ymir-sdl3 -f      # Avvio in fullscreen

🔹 Problemi Conosciuti

Alcuni giochi hanno ancora problemi:
❌ Freeze durante il gameplay:

  • Daytona USA (versione originale)

  • Sakura Taisen (premere B per skippare i dialoghi)

  • Shining Force 3 (Scenario 1)

❌ Bloccati alla schermata SEGA:

  • Marvel vs. Street Fighter

  • Virtua Cop 2

  • X-Men vs. Street Fighter


🔹 Quale Versione Scaricare?

  • AVX2 → Migliori prestazioni (CPU moderne)

  • SSE2 → Compatibile con PC vecchi

  • Win32 → Senza terminale (preferibile su Windows)

📌 Scarica oraGitHub Releases

Provatelo e fateci sapere cosa ne pensate! 🚀

Da FRANCESCO

Sviluppatore a tempo perso nato negli anni 80, amante delle console e delle retro console.Il mio motto è quello di aiutare il prossimo senza avere rimorsi di cio' che hai fatto.

Lascia un commento

Il tuo indirizzo email non sarà pubblicato. I campi obbligatori sono contrassegnati *

Questo sito utilizza Akismet per ridurre lo spam. Scopri come vengono elaborati i dati derivati dai commenti.